#f8c2de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f8c2de is composed of 97.3% red, 76.1%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.8% magenta, 10.5%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 328.9 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 86.7%. #f8c2de color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f185bd.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#f8c2de

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090105 is the darkest color, while #fef7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#f8c2de

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dedcdd is the less saturated color, while #fdbdde is the most saturated one.
